Overview

For relevant automation rule types, Nucleus enables you to set up flexible asset matching filters to use in creating automation rules. The filters use matching conditions designed to ensure your automation rules are applied only to the assets you want to include. You can also leverage any custom asset metadata you create in these filters.

These are descriptions of the matching conditions for ticketing automation rules:

Condition Description Field Type
All Create tickets for all assets affected by this unique vulnerability All
Asset Group Create tickets only for assets that are in (all of/one of) the selected asset groups Searchable dropdown
Asset Name Create tickets for all assets which match a certain name or naming convention Textfield with exact matching, wildcard matching, or full regex matching
IP Create tickets for all assets with a certain IP, IP range, or comma separate list of IPs IP Field
Asset Type Create tickets for all assets of a specific type Dropdown
Custom Fields Create tickets for all assets which match a custom asset field Textfield with exact matching, wildcard matching, or full regex matching
Custom Asset Fields

Nucleus allows you to import custom metadata fields for all assets from either external systems such as ServiceNow CMDB, API, or asset csv upload. You can use these fields in all asset matching and ticketing rules for maximum flexibility.
